Illustration Friday - Legendary


Legendary Beauty: a collage
For those of you who aren't aware, the figure on the shell is Aphrodite / Venus the Greek / Roman goddess of love and beauty.  The Greek figure on the right is Helen of Troy, a woman so beautiful that men went to war over her (The Trojan War) and the goddesses were jealous of her.  Other than that there's Marilyn Monroe the legendary voluptuous blonde and Audrey Hepburn the legendary elfin brunette.  Then there's the modern beauties, Angelina Joile (my favourite), Charlize Theron and I can't think of who the other is.  The 3 in the background are randoms from catalogues I had lying around.  The poem was written by the legendary Lord Byron.
